Building Resilient Digital Enterprises in 2025: The Role of Database Administration, Cybersecurity, and Vulnerability Assessment

The digital-first economy of 2025 demands more from enterprises than ever before. Data volumes are doubling every few years, cyber threats are becoming more advanced, and compliance frameworks are increasingly strict. In this landscape, organizations that can manage data efficiently, defend against evolving attacks, and proactively address weaknesses will thrive, while those that don't will struggle to survive. At the heart of this resilience lie three interdependent technology pillars : Database Administration – ensuring reliability, scalability, and efficiency. Cybersecurity – protecting digital assets from attacks and breaches. Vulnerability Assessment – identifying and fixing weaknesses before adversaries exploit them. This blog explores how these domains are shaping enterprises in 2025 and why integration between them is no longer optional — it's essential.
